The Certificate in Website Development & Management combines visual design, marketing savvy and technology skills, enabling students to create attractive and functional websites. The program emphasizes the basic principles of web design, and teaches the techniques that will allow you to use multimedia content for interactive presentations and commercial websites.
Some helpful definitions: Website managers analyze user needs to implement website content, graphics, performance and user capacity. Web graphic designers may develop or convert graphic, audio and video components into compatible Web formats by using software designed to facilitate the creation of Web and multimedia content.
The Certificate in Website Development & Management is designed to prepare graduates for entry-level positions such as:
- Web content manager
- Social media content developer
- Web designer
- Web administrator
- Graphic designer
